1. Plan First

What’s your vision for your backyard? Before you agree to a pool-building contract, you will want to have some idea of what you want. Are you going to be using it for fun, relaxation or perhaps physical fitness? The shape and scope will be essential when you start your search. For example, if you are into fitness, you may want to consider a lap pool.

2. Figure Out Your Timeline

An indoor pool — and, perhaps, a well-designed pool deck around it — won’t be ready overnight. It won’t even be done in a week.

Instead, you should get ready to wait anywhere from two to three months for your project to end. It’s not just the building process that will have you waiting, though. The project will require permits, backyard excavation and more.

When you decide to build a pool in Arizona, you can use your pool for more months of the year than people in more temperate climates. That means you don’t necessarily have to rush to get your pool done by spring so you can use it all summer. But you should keep the two-to-three-month timeline in mind so you have your pool by the time it’s hot again.

3. Save Your Cash

Installing a backyard pool isn’t a project to take lightly. As you search for inspiration for your project, get your funds ready, too.

For one thing, the ground in Arizona is pretty hard, which makes it more of a strenuous — and expensive — task to excavate the pool. Then, the materials you choose for your pool could bump up the price, too. Concrete costs more than, say, vinyl.
